Car Race for Efficiency

Watch this video about super-efficient car races on HowStuffWorks. In 2004 the record fuel efficiency for a combustion engine vehicle was set by a team from France at 3410 kilometers per liter. In 2005 a hydrogen fuel-cell vehicle from Switzerland managed the equivalent of 3836 kilometers per liter - the equivalent of driving from Paris to Moscow on one liter of fuel.
